<table/>

table : suite de rangs

Le modèle de contenu est basé sur celui des tableaux en HTML. Mais la plupart du temps, l'insertion des éléments nécessaires à la construction d'un tableau est géré par l'éditeur XML (outil d'aide à l'édition).

htm:table<1> dbk:table<2> tei:table<3>

Exemple 1.
<!-- Idem à un tabeau en HTML -->
<table>
<!-- élément de niveau bloc, comme para -->
<tr>
<!-- Première rangée -->
<th>
<!-- Cellule titre de la première colonne -->
</th>
<th>
<!-- Cellule titre de la deuxième colonne -->
</th>
</tr>
<tr>
<!-- Deuxième rangée -->
<td>
<para>
<!-- Cellule de la première colonne -->
</para>
</td>
<td>
<para>
<!-- Cellule de la deuxième colonne -->
</para>
</td>
</tr>
<tr>
<!-- Troisième rangée -->
<td>
<para>
<!-- Cellule de la première colonne -->
</para>
</td>
<td>
<para>
<!-- Cellule de la deuxième colonne -->
</para>
</td>
</tr>
</table>

Parents<^>

answer, article, available, bibliography, calendar, chapter, contents, definition, description, example, excerpt, faq, figure, glossary, index, item, note, para, part, procedure, section, set, step ;

Frères<^>

%Block, %Formal, %Inline, %List ; answer, chapter, colophon, concept, contents, definition, event, index, info, part, question, record, resource, section, source, step, summary, term, title, xml ;

Enfants<^>

(info?, title?, ( (thead?, tbody+, tfoot?) |  (tr+)))

Attributs<^>

  • @id="xs:ID"
  • @code="xs:string"
  • @audience="xs:string"
  • @css="xs:string"
  • @class="xs:string"
  • @remap="xs:string"
  • @uri="xs:anyURI"
  • @lang="xs:string"
  • @value="xs:string"
  • @role="xs:string"
  • @scheme="xs:string"
  • Source<^>

    <xs:element name="table" type="table"/>
    <xs:complexType name="table">
    <xs:sequence>
    <xs:element minOccurs="0" ref="info"/>
    <xs:element minOccurs="0" ref="title"/>
    <xs:choice>
    <xs:sequence>
    <xs:element minOccurs="0" ref="thead"/>
    <xs:element maxOccurs="unbounded" ref="tbody"/>
    <xs:element minOccurs="0" ref="tfoot"/>
    </xs:sequence>
    <xs:sequence>
    <xs:element maxOccurs="unbounded" ref="tr"/>
    </xs:sequence>
    </xs:choice>
    <!--  CB + 12/11/03 -->
    </xs:sequence>
    <xs:attributeGroup ref="Attributes"/>
    </xs:complexType>


    <1> http://www.w3.org/TR/html4/struct/tables.html#edef-TABLE

    <2> http://www.docbook.org/tdg/en/html/table.html

    <3> http://www.tei-c.org/P4X/ref-TABLE.html